Erreur HTTP 500 sur WordPress : causes et solutions simples expliquées

Erreur HTTP 500 sur WordPress : causes et solutions simples expliquées

Lors de l'exécution d'un WordPress Sur un site web, peu de problèmes sont plus frustrants que de voir apparaître le message “ Erreur HTTP 500 ” à l'écran. Le site cesse soudainement de fonctionner, les pages ne se chargent plus et les visiteurs se retrouvent face à une page d'erreur.

Pour les propriétaires de sites web, les développeurs et les entreprises de commerce électronique, ce problème peut être source de vives inquiétudes. Heureusement, l'erreur HTTP 500 (wordpress) est assez courante et se résout généralement en quelques étapes de dépannage.

Ce guide vous explique la signification de cette erreur, ses causes et comment la corriger en toute sécurité. Même sans être développeur, comprendre les bases vous permettra de restaurer votre site web plus rapidement et d'éviter que le problème ne se reproduise.

Qu’est-ce que l’erreur HTTP 500 dans WordPress ?

Erreur HTTP 500 WordPress : Causes et solutions simples expliquées - Qu'est-ce que l'erreur HTTP 500 dans WordPress ?

L'erreur HTTP 500 (Erreur interne du serveur) est une erreur serveur générale indiquant qu'un problème est survenu sur le serveur du site web, mais que le serveur ne peut pas en déterminer la cause exacte.

En termes plus simples, cela signifie :

Le serveur comprend la requête mais ne peut pas la traiter en raison d'un problème interne.

Contrairement à d'autres erreurs telles que :

  • Erreur 404 – page introuvable
  • Erreur 403 – accès interdit
  • Erreur 502 – passerelle incorrecte

Le message d'erreur HTTP 500 wordpress ne vous indique pas exactement la cause du problème.

C'est pourquoi le dépannage est nécessaire.

Cette erreur peut apparaître de plusieurs manières, notamment :

  • “ Erreur interne du serveur 500 ”
  • “ Erreur HTTP 500 ”
  • “"Erreur interne du serveur"”
  • Une page blanche vierge
  • “ Le site web rencontre des difficultés techniques. ”

Même si le message peut sembler différent, la cause profonde est souvent liée à des problèmes de configuration, de plugins, de thèmes ou de limites du serveur.

Pourquoi l'erreur HTTP 500 se produit-elle sur WordPress ?

Erreur HTTP 500 sur WordPress : causes et solutions simples expliquées - Pourquoi l'erreur HTTP 500 se produit-elle sur WordPress ?

Comprendre les causes potentielles est la première étape pour résoudre le problème.

Vous trouverez ci-dessous les raisons les plus courantes pour lesquelles les sites web WordPress rencontrent l'erreur HTTP 500 wordpress.

Fichier .htaccess corrompu

Le fichier .htaccess contrôle des règles serveur importantes pour WordPress. Il gère des tâches telles que les redirections, la structure des permaliens et les paramètres de sécurité.

Si ce fichier est corrompu ou contient des règles incorrectes, le serveur risque de ne pas pouvoir traiter correctement les requêtes.

Une panne .htaccess Les fichiers corrompus sont l'une des causes les plus fréquentes de l'erreur HTTP 500.

Les raisons courantes de la corruption sont les suivantes :

  • modifications manuelles incorrectes
  • modifications du plugin
  • erreurs de migration
  • conflits de configuration du serveur

Heureusement, résoudre ce problème est généralement simple.

Conflits de plugins

Les plugins WordPress ajoutent des fonctionnalités puissantes, mais ils peuvent également créer des problèmes de compatibilité.

Il arrive parfois qu'un plugin :

  • conflit avec un autre plugin
  • être incompatible avec votre thème
  • ne prend pas en charge la version actuelle de WordPress
  • dépassement des limites du serveur

Dans ce cas, WordPress peut ne pas fonctionner correctement et déclencher le message d'erreur HTTP 500 wordpress.

Si vous avez récemment installé ou mis à jour un plugin avant l'apparition de l'erreur, ce plugin pourrait être à l'origine du problème.

Problèmes liés au thème

Les thèmes contrôlent la mise en page visuelle d'un site WordPress, mais des thèmes mal codés ou des mises à jour incompatibles peuvent rendre le site inutilisable.

Une erreur liée au thème peut provoquer :

  • Échecs d'exécution PHP
  • problèmes de chargement de modèles
  • conflits de serveurs

Passer à un thème WordPress par défaut peut aider à déterminer si le thème est responsable du problème.

Problèmes de limite de mémoire PHP

WordPress utilise PHP pour traiter les requêtes. Si votre site web manque de mémoire PHP disponible, le serveur risque d'interrompre l'exécution des scripts.

Cela est particulièrement fréquent lorsque :

  • Des plugins volumineux sont installés
  • Les boutiques en ligne exécutent des requêtes complexes.
  • de nombreux plugins fonctionnent simultanément

Lorsque la mémoire PHP est épuisée, le serveur peut répondre par le message d'erreur HTTP 500 wordpress.

Augmenter la limite de mémoire PHP résout souvent ce problème.

Fichiers WordPress principaux corrompus

Bien que rare, il est possible que des fichiers WordPress essentiels soient endommagés lors de :

  • échec des mises à jour
  • Téléchargements incomplets
  • attaques de logiciels malveillants
  • interruptions du serveur

Lorsque les fichiers principaux sont corrompus, WordPress risque de ne pas fonctionner correctement, ce qui entraîne une erreur serveur.

Le rechargement de fichiers WordPress récents peut résoudre le problème.

Autorisations de fichier incorrectes

Les serveurs s'appuient sur les permissions d'accès aux fichiers pour déterminer qui peut accéder aux fichiers ou les modifier.

Si les permissions sont mal configurées, le serveur peut empêcher WordPress d'exécuter certains fichiers.

Les autorisations correctes typiques comprennent :

  • Dossiers : 755
  • Fichiers : 644

En cas de mauvaise configuration des permissions, le site peut déclencher une réponse d'erreur HTTP 500 wordpress.

Comment corriger l'erreur HTTP 500 sur WordPress

Erreur HTTP 500 sur WordPress : causes et solutions simples expliquées - Comment corriger l'erreur HTTP 500 sur WordPress

Maintenant que nous comprenons les causes possibles, passons en revue les étapes de dépannage les plus efficaces.

Ces méthodes sont couramment utilisées par les professionnels de WordPress pour diagnostiquer et résoudre le problème.

Étape 1 : Vérifier et réinitialiser le fichier .htaccess

Depuis .htaccess Le fichier est une cause fréquente de cette erreur ; le vérifier devrait être votre première étape.

Voici un processus simple :

  1. Connectez-vous à votre site web via FTP ou le gestionnaire de fichiers de votre hébergement.
  2. Localisez le .htaccess fichier dans le répertoire racine.
  3. Renommez-le en quelque chose comme :
.htaccess-ancien
  1. Actualisez votre site web.

Si le site se remet à fonctionner, c'est que le fichier était corrompu.

Vous pouvez générer un nouveau .htaccess Déposer un fichier en allant à :

Tableau de bord WordPress → Réglages → Permaliens → Enregistrer les modifications

WordPress créera automatiquement un nouveau fichier de configuration.

Étape 2 : Désactiver tous les plugins

Si l'erreur est due à un conflit de plugins, la désactivation de tous les plugins permet d'identifier rapidement le problème.

Si vous pouvez accéder au tableau de bord WordPress :

  1. Accéder aux plugins
  2. Sélectionner tous les plugins
  3. Choisissez Désactiver

Si vous ne pouvez pas accéder au tableau de bord :

  1. Connexion via FTP
  2. Accédez au dossier wp-content
  3. Renommez le dossier des plugins en :
plugins désactivés

Cela oblige WordPress à désactiver tous les plugins.

Si le site web se charge normalement par la suite, vous pouvez renommer le dossier et réactiver les plugins un par un pour trouver celui qui pose problème.

Étape 3 : Passer à un thème WordPress par défaut

Parfois, le thème actif est responsable du problème d'erreur HTTP 500 wordpress.

Pour tester cela, passez temporairement à un thème par défaut comme :

  • Vingt-vingt-un
  • Vingt-deux-deux
  • Vingt-vingt-trois

Si l'erreur disparaît après avoir changé de thème, le problème provient probablement du code du thème ou de sa compatibilité.

Étape 4 : Augmenter la limite de mémoire PHP

Si votre site web exécute des opérations complexes ou utilise plusieurs plugins, augmenter la limite de mémoire PHP peut résoudre le problème.

Vous pouvez ajouter la ligne suivante à votre fichier wp-config.php :

définir('WP_MEMORY_LIMIT', '256M');

Votre fournisseur d'hébergement peut également vous permettre d'augmenter la mémoire via le panneau de configuration du serveur.

Pour les sites de commerce électronique ou les installations WordPress plus importantes, il est souvent nécessaire d'augmenter la mémoire.

Étape 5 : Téléverser à nouveau les fichiers principaux de WordPress

Si les fichiers principaux de WordPress sont endommagés, leur remplacement par des copies neuves peut rétablir leur fonctionnement.

Voici comment :

  1. Téléchargez le dernier package WordPress sur WordPress.org
  2. Extraire les fichiers
  3. Téléversez les dossiers wp-admin et wp-includes via FTP
  4. Écraser les dossiers existants

Important:
Ne remplacez pas le dossier wp-content ni le fichier wp-config.php, car ils contiennent votre contenu et votre configuration.

Étape 6 : Vérifier les autorisations des fichiers

Des permissions de fichiers incorrectes peuvent également déclencher des erreurs de serveur.

Utilisez FTP ou votre panneau de contrôle d'hébergement pour vous assurer que les autorisations sont correctement configurées :

Dossiers :

755

Fichiers :

644

Ces paramètres permettent à WordPress de fonctionner normalement sans exposer le serveur à des risques de sécurité.

Étape 7 : Contactez votre fournisseur d’hébergement

Si aucune des solutions ci-dessus ne résout le problème, celui-ci peut être lié à l'environnement d'hébergement.

Votre fournisseur d'hébergement peut vous aider à vérifier :

  • journaux du serveur
  • Configuration PHP
  • règles de pare-feu
  • limites des ressources du serveur

Les journaux du serveur révèlent souvent la cause exacte du problème d'erreur HTTP 500 wordpress.

Comment éviter l'erreur HTTP 500 dans WordPress

Bien que cette erreur puisse être corrigée, la prévention est toujours préférable.

Voici plusieurs pratiques permettant de réduire le risque de rencontrer l'erreur HTTP 500 wordpress.

Maintenez WordPress à jour

Toujours mettre à jour :

  • Noyau WordPress
  • thèmes
  • plugins

Les mises à jour comprennent généralement des correctifs de sécurité et des améliorations de compatibilité.

Évitez d'utiliser trop de plugins.

L'installation d'un trop grand nombre de plugins augmente le risque de conflits et de surcharge du serveur.

Essayez de :

  • Utilisez des plugins bien évalués.
  • supprimer les plugins inutilisés
  • choisir des outils légers

Une configuration de plugins plus propre permet d'obtenir un site web plus stable.

Utilisez un hébergement fiable

Les performances et la configuration du serveur jouent un rôle majeur dans la stabilité d'un site web.

Choisissez un hébergement qui propose :

  • mémoire PHP suffisante
  • environnements WordPress optimisés
  • disponibilité fiable
  • sécurité renforcée

Un hébergeur de qualité peut prévenir de nombreuses erreurs de serveur.

Effectuez des sauvegardes régulières

Les sauvegardes vous permettent de restaurer rapidement votre site web en cas de problème.

De nombreux hébergeurs proposent des solutions de sauvegarde automatisées, et les plugins de sauvegarde WordPress peuvent également s'avérer utiles.

Disposer d'une sauvegarde signifie qu'une erreur de serveur ne causera pas de dommages permanents.

Réflexions finales

L'affichage du message d'erreur HTTP 500 wordpress peut être alarmant, mais dans la plupart des cas, le problème est résoluble.

En vérifiant .htaccess En modifiant les fichiers, en désactivant les plugins, en changeant de thème, en augmentant les limites de mémoire et en vérifiant les paramètres du serveur, la plupart des propriétaires de sites web peuvent restaurer leur site. WordPress Site sans complications majeures.

Pour les entreprises qui gèrent des boutiques en ligne, des sites web ou des marques internationales, la stabilité de leur site est essentielle. Les problèmes techniques perturbent non seulement les visiteurs, mais peuvent aussi impacter le référencement et la confiance des clients.

C’est pourquoi de nombreuses entreprises choisissent de travailler avec des professionnels spécialisés dans la conception, l’optimisation et la maintenance de sites web.

Au AIRSANG, Nous nous spécialisons dans l'accompagnement des marques internationales pour la création et la maintenance de sites web performants. Notre expertise couvre la conception WordPress, le développement de boutiques Shopify et les solutions e-commerce sur mesure pour les entreprises internationales.

Si vous rencontrez des problèmes tels que l'erreur HTTP 500 wordpress ou si vous souhaitez créer un site web plus rapide et plus fiable pour votre marque, notre équipe peut vous accompagner tout au long du processus.

Un site web bien conçu est bien plus qu'une simple question d'esthétique : c'est le fondement d'une activité en ligne prospère.

Et c'est précisément ce que nous visons à offrir chez AIRSANG.

Livraison dans le monde entier

AIRSANG propose des solutions économiques de conception de sites web, d'identité visuelle de marque et de commerce électronique. De Shopify et WordPress aux images de produits Amazon, Nous aidons les marques internationales à bâtir, à développer et à faire croître leur activité en ligne.

Nous concevons et réalisons pour vous un site web WordPress ou un site d'entreprise avec un système de commerce électronique complet.
Exigences personnalisées ou devis spéciaux

Exigences personnalisées ou devis spéciaux

Prix initial : $2.00.Prix actuel : $1.00.

Prêt à transformer votre entreprise ?

Prenez rendez-vous pour en savoir plus sur la façon dont notre agence de marketing numérique peut faire passer votre entreprise à la vitesse supérieure.